The use of AI-generated photos on dating apps is not a new one, there’s an AI device that creates photos specifically for dating apps, and people have started noticing AI-generated photos on other mans users. Hinge’s parent company Match Group declined an interview about whether it’s aware of AI-generated photos being used on profiles and if it’s doing anything about it. Instead, a representative said that Tinder, which is also owned by Match Group, is working on “an AI-powered tool to help select photos for profiles,” which sounds similar to the one Bumble already uses.

One of my favorite subreddits to peruse is r/InstagramReality. Redditors post edited or filtered photos and videos of other people – celebrities, influencers, and normal folks – they have found on social media, usually next to ones of what the person looks like in real life.

Often, the editing or filtering is comically overdone and obvious. But, sometimes, Redditors have to point out in which one thing warp or change were made to show that it’s not real.

It’s scary how rampant and an excessive amount of editing gets. The comments in the subreddit often touch on human anatomy dysmorphic illness (BDD) because, really, how else could people put some of these photos out there and think they look normal?
